Product designer Joe Mattley has exactly done by contriving a kinetic energy charger that can be used to power up a myriad of small devices such as mobiles phones, flashlights and even digital cameras.
Named as the FREEcharge, this charger incorporates a magnetic system for clean electricity generation. This effective sliding magnet induces a 2500 turn copper coil (in a solenoid form) to produce the resultant electricity. The movement of the magnet in turn is governed by the motion of the whole contraption, thus kinetic energy being utilized in the process to be converted to electrical energy. During testing phase, the whole system was assayed numerous times to make the prototype as efficacious as possible.
The portability of the conception along with its non-requirement of any type of power outlet makes it apt for people on the move. According to the designer, his invention will cater to a particular segment of customers like hikers, adventurers and outdoor campers. Moreover, being completely regulated to zero carbon emission, the charger also makes its ‘green’ mark on the sustainable side of affairs.
